The Butyl Rubber Market was valued at USD 3.56 billion in 2024 and is projected to grow to USD 3.87 billion in 2025, with a CAGR of 8.84%, reaching USD 5.92 billion by 2030.
KEY MARKET STATISTICS | |
---|---|
Base Year [2024] | USD 3.56 billion |
Estimated Year [2025] | USD 3.87 billion |
Forecast Year [2030] | USD 5.92 billion |
CAGR (%) | 8.84% |
Butyl rubber stands at the crossroads of innovation and tradition, representing a material that has continually evolved to meet the demanding requirements of modern industries. Its unique balance of impermeability and flexibility has established it as a material of choice across diverse sectors. In an era characterized by rapid technological advancement, the significance of butyl rubber in enhancing product performance cannot be overstated. The material's inherent chemical resistance, durability, and remarkable energy-absorbing properties have spurred its adoption in products that demand reliability and longevity. Key Segmentation Insights Across Product, End-User, and Application
A detailed segmentation analysis reveals a multifaceted market that is characterized by clear distinctions in product type, end-user industry, and application areas. The product segmentation uncovers a diverse range of butyl rubber types including Bromobutyl Rubber, Chlorobutyl Rubber, Exxon Butyl, Regular Butyl Rubber, and Starbutyl. This variety underscores the tailored nature of products designed to satisfy specific performance requirements, such as enhanced durability in certain applications or superior resistance properties in others. Parallelly, when the market is segmented by end-user industry, the predominant sectors include Automotive, Construction, Consumer Goods, Industrial, and Pharmaceutical and Healthcare. Each of these industries leverages butyl rubber for its distinct characteristics - from sealing and insulation in automotive and construction applications to specialized products in the pharmaceutical and healthcare segments. Another layer of depth in segmentation arises from the application perspective, where butyl rubber is integrated into Adhesives & Sealants, used in Automotive Parts Production, deployed within the Chemical and Petrochemical Industry, embedded in Consumer Goods, applied in Industrial Products & Machinery Manufacturing, and embraced by sectors such as Medical and Pharmaceutical Products, Medical Tubing, Sports Equipment, Thermal Insulation, and Tire Manufacturing. This broad array of applications signifies not only the versatility but also the market's dependence on butyl rubber as a critical input in a wide variety of high-value processes.
